How to install GBA4iOS on iOS 10 for iPhone and iPad

install custom rom GBA4iOS

Follow the steps below to install GBA4iOS on iOS 10 for your iPhone or iPad:

Step 1: Open Safari and go to http://iemulators.com/gba4ios.

Step 2: Tap GBA4iOS icon.  It will open a new page with description of GBA4iOS emulator.

Step 3: Go to the end of the page.  Tap the ‘Install’ button to download GBA4iOS v2.1. A dialog box will pop up asking you to confirm installation.  Hit ‘Install.’

Step 4: When the download completes, an icon will be placed on the home screen.

Step 5: Now go to Settings > General > Profile.

Step 6: Find its certificate starting with word ‘Qingdao’ and tap ‘Trust.’

Step 7: Now you have successfully installed GBA4iOS.

Now you can launch GBA4iOS emulator by taping its icon to open it.  Get the custom ROMs for GBA4iOS for your favorite games to start playing.

Custom ROMs for GBA4iOS emulator

Get custom ROMs for GBA4iOS from various websites such as ‘Love ROMs’ or ‘CoolRom.’ Use the search icon in GBA4iOS to search for custom ROMs for GBA4iOS.  Once you download the ROM for your favorite game, choose ‘Open in…’ and then choose GBA4iOS to load your game.
